Skip to content

Commit 7e3f934

Browse files
committed
add prometheus measurements
1 parent 1021b05 commit 7e3f934

10 files changed

+56377
-0
lines changed

.gitignore

+1
Original file line numberDiff line numberDiff line change
@@ -10,6 +10,7 @@ cryptokeys/
1010
state/
1111

1212
*.json
13+
!measurements/**/*.json
1314
*.pdf
1415
*.gv
1516
*.profile
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,195 @@
1+
{
2+
"params": [
3+
"prometheus_query.py",
4+
"-m",
5+
"aggregated_attestation_gossip_slot_start_delay_time_bucket",
6+
"-n",
7+
"0.95",
8+
"0.9",
9+
"0.8",
10+
"0.7",
11+
"0.6",
12+
"0.5",
13+
"0.4",
14+
"0.3",
15+
"0.2",
16+
"0.1",
17+
"0.05",
18+
"-b",
19+
"19d",
20+
"-q",
21+
"-8",
22+
"-t",
23+
"1629244800",
24+
"-o",
25+
"attestation_agg_paper.json",
26+
"quantile"
27+
],
28+
"results": {
29+
"http://ubuntu:9090/api/v1/query?query=histogram_quantile(0.95, sum(rate(aggregated_attestation_gossip_slot_start_delay_time_bucket[19d])) by (le)) -8&time=1629244800": {
30+
"status": "success",
31+
"data": {
32+
"resultType": "vector",
33+
"result": [
34+
{
35+
"metric": {},
36+
"value": [
37+
1629244800,
38+
"11.22290237116582"
39+
]
40+
}
41+
]
42+
}
43+
},
44+
"http://ubuntu:9090/api/v1/query?query=histogram_quantile(0.9, sum(rate(aggregated_attestation_gossip_slot_start_delay_time_bucket[19d])) by (le)) -8&time=1629244800": {
45+
"status": "success",
46+
"data": {
47+
"resultType": "vector",
48+
"result": [
49+
{
50+
"metric": {},
51+
"value": [
52+
1629244800,
53+
"9.47152809954147"
54+
]
55+
}
56+
]
57+
}
58+
},
59+
"http://ubuntu:9090/api/v1/query?query=histogram_quantile(0.8, sum(rate(aggregated_attestation_gossip_slot_start_delay_time_bucket[19d])) by (le)) -8&time=1629244800": {
60+
"status": "success",
61+
"data": {
62+
"resultType": "vector",
63+
"result": [
64+
{
65+
"metric": {},
66+
"value": [
67+
1629244800,
68+
"6.841446811067463"
69+
]
70+
}
71+
]
72+
}
73+
},
74+
"http://ubuntu:9090/api/v1/query?query=histogram_quantile(0.7, sum(rate(aggregated_attestation_gossip_slot_start_delay_time_bucket[19d])) by (le)) -8&time=1629244800": {
75+
"status": "success",
76+
"data": {
77+
"resultType": "vector",
78+
"result": [
79+
{
80+
"metric": {},
81+
"value": [
82+
1629244800,
83+
"4.843573804530072"
84+
]
85+
}
86+
]
87+
}
88+
},
89+
"http://ubuntu:9090/api/v1/query?query=histogram_quantile(0.6, sum(rate(aggregated_attestation_gossip_slot_start_delay_time_bucket[19d])) by (le)) -8&time=1629244800": {
90+
"status": "success",
91+
"data": {
92+
"resultType": "vector",
93+
"result": [
94+
{
95+
"metric": {},
96+
"value": [
97+
1629244800,
98+
"2.4297550350292827"
99+
]
100+
}
101+
]
102+
}
103+
},
104+
"http://ubuntu:9090/api/v1/query?query=histogram_quantile(0.5, sum(rate(aggregated_attestation_gossip_slot_start_delay_time_bucket[19d])) by (le)) -8&time=1629244800": {
105+
"status": "success",
106+
"data": {
107+
"resultType": "vector",
108+
"result": [
109+
{
110+
"metric": {},
111+
"value": [
112+
1629244800,
113+
"1.7111743538541724"
114+
]
115+
}
116+
]
117+
}
118+
},
119+
"http://ubuntu:9090/api/v1/query?query=histogram_quantile(0.4, sum(rate(aggregated_attestation_gossip_slot_start_delay_time_bucket[19d])) by (le)) -8&time=1629244800": {
120+
"status": "success",
121+
"data": {
122+
"resultType": "vector",
123+
"result": [
124+
{
125+
"metric": {},
126+
"value": [
127+
1629244800,
128+
"1.3680995641633515"
129+
]
130+
}
131+
]
132+
}
133+
},
134+
"http://ubuntu:9090/api/v1/query?query=histogram_quantile(0.3, sum(rate(aggregated_attestation_gossip_slot_start_delay_time_bucket[19d])) by (le)) -8&time=1629244800": {
135+
"status": "success",
136+
"data": {
137+
"resultType": "vector",
138+
"result": [
139+
{
140+
"metric": {},
141+
"value": [
142+
1629244800,
143+
"1.0250247744725325"
144+
]
145+
}
146+
]
147+
}
148+
},
149+
"http://ubuntu:9090/api/v1/query?query=histogram_quantile(0.2, sum(rate(aggregated_attestation_gossip_slot_start_delay_time_bucket[19d])) by (le)) -8&time=1629244800": {
150+
"status": "success",
151+
"data": {
152+
"resultType": "vector",
153+
"result": [
154+
{
155+
"metric": {},
156+
"value": [
157+
1629244800,
158+
"0.6819499847817134"
159+
]
160+
}
161+
]
162+
}
163+
},
164+
"http://ubuntu:9090/api/v1/query?query=histogram_quantile(0.1, sum(rate(aggregated_attestation_gossip_slot_start_delay_time_bucket[19d])) by (le)) -8&time=1629244800": {
165+
"status": "success",
166+
"data": {
167+
"resultType": "vector",
168+
"result": [
169+
{
170+
"metric": {},
171+
"value": [
172+
1629244800,
173+
"0.33887519509089437"
174+
]
175+
}
176+
]
177+
}
178+
},
179+
"http://ubuntu:9090/api/v1/query?query=histogram_quantile(0.05, sum(rate(aggregated_attestation_gossip_slot_start_delay_time_bucket[19d])) by (le)) -8&time=1629244800": {
180+
"status": "success",
181+
"data": {
182+
"resultType": "vector",
183+
"result": [
184+
{
185+
"metric": {},
186+
"value": [
187+
1629244800,
188+
"0.16733780024548395"
189+
]
190+
}
191+
]
192+
}
193+
}
194+
}
195+
}
+193
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,193 @@
1+
{
2+
"params": [
3+
"prometheus_query.py",
4+
"-m",
5+
"attestation_gossip_slot_start_delay_time_bucket",
6+
"-n",
7+
"0.95",
8+
"0.9",
9+
"0.8",
10+
"0.7",
11+
"0.6",
12+
"0.5",
13+
"0.4",
14+
"0.3",
15+
"0.2",
16+
"0.1",
17+
"0.05",
18+
"-b",
19+
"19d",
20+
"-t",
21+
"1629244800",
22+
"-o",
23+
"attestation_paper.json",
24+
"quantile"
25+
],
26+
"results": {
27+
"http://ubuntu:9090/api/v1/query?query=histogram_quantile(0.95, sum(rate(attestation_gossip_slot_start_delay_time_bucket[19d])) by (le)) &time=1629244800": {
28+
"status": "success",
29+
"data": {
30+
"resultType": "vector",
31+
"result": [
32+
{
33+
"metric": {},
34+
"value": [
35+
1629244800,
36+
"8.298512754154139"
37+
]
38+
}
39+
]
40+
}
41+
},
42+
"http://ubuntu:9090/api/v1/query?query=histogram_quantile(0.9, sum(rate(attestation_gossip_slot_start_delay_time_bucket[19d])) by (le)) &time=1629244800": {
43+
"status": "success",
44+
"data": {
45+
"resultType": "vector",
46+
"result": [
47+
{
48+
"metric": {},
49+
"value": [
50+
1629244800,
51+
"7.4629312329309805"
52+
]
53+
}
54+
]
55+
}
56+
},
57+
"http://ubuntu:9090/api/v1/query?query=histogram_quantile(0.8, sum(rate(attestation_gossip_slot_start_delay_time_bucket[19d])) by (le)) &time=1629244800": {
58+
"status": "success",
59+
"data": {
60+
"resultType": "vector",
61+
"result": [
62+
{
63+
"metric": {},
64+
"value": [
65+
1629244800,
66+
"6.310560175396256"
67+
]
68+
}
69+
]
70+
}
71+
},
72+
"http://ubuntu:9090/api/v1/query?query=histogram_quantile(0.7, sum(rate(attestation_gossip_slot_start_delay_time_bucket[19d])) by (le)) &time=1629244800": {
73+
"status": "success",
74+
"data": {
75+
"resultType": "vector",
76+
"result": [
77+
{
78+
"metric": {},
79+
"value": [
80+
1629244800,
81+
"5.613939158703568"
82+
]
83+
}
84+
]
85+
}
86+
},
87+
"http://ubuntu:9090/api/v1/query?query=histogram_quantile(0.6, sum(rate(attestation_gossip_slot_start_delay_time_bucket[19d])) by (le)) &time=1629244800": {
88+
"status": "success",
89+
"data": {
90+
"resultType": "vector",
91+
"result": [
92+
{
93+
"metric": {},
94+
"value": [
95+
1629244800,
96+
"5.0854530706794225"
97+
]
98+
}
99+
]
100+
}
101+
},
102+
"http://ubuntu:9090/api/v1/query?query=histogram_quantile(0.5, sum(rate(attestation_gossip_slot_start_delay_time_bucket[19d])) by (le)) &time=1629244800": {
103+
"status": "success",
104+
"data": {
105+
"resultType": "vector",
106+
"result": [
107+
{
108+
"metric": {},
109+
"value": [
110+
1629244800,
111+
"4.556966982655278"
112+
]
113+
}
114+
]
115+
}
116+
},
117+
"http://ubuntu:9090/api/v1/query?query=histogram_quantile(0.4, sum(rate(attestation_gossip_slot_start_delay_time_bucket[19d])) by (le)) &time=1629244800": {
118+
"status": "success",
119+
"data": {
120+
"resultType": "vector",
121+
"result": [
122+
{
123+
"metric": {},
124+
"value": [
125+
1629244800,
126+
"4.028480894631134"
127+
]
128+
}
129+
]
130+
}
131+
},
132+
"http://ubuntu:9090/api/v1/query?query=histogram_quantile(0.3, sum(rate(attestation_gossip_slot_start_delay_time_bucket[19d])) by (le)) &time=1629244800": {
133+
"status": "success",
134+
"data": {
135+
"resultType": "vector",
136+
"result": [
137+
{
138+
"metric": {},
139+
"value": [
140+
1629244800,
141+
"3.03815359297057"
142+
]
143+
}
144+
]
145+
}
146+
},
147+
"http://ubuntu:9090/api/v1/query?query=histogram_quantile(0.2, sum(rate(attestation_gossip_slot_start_delay_time_bucket[19d])) by (le)) &time=1629244800": {
148+
"status": "success",
149+
"data": {
150+
"resultType": "vector",
151+
"result": [
152+
{
153+
"metric": {},
154+
"value": [
155+
1629244800,
156+
"2.021519262671698"
157+
]
158+
}
159+
]
160+
}
161+
},
162+
"http://ubuntu:9090/api/v1/query?query=histogram_quantile(0.1, sum(rate(attestation_gossip_slot_start_delay_time_bucket[19d])) by (le)) &time=1629244800": {
163+
"status": "success",
164+
"data": {
165+
"resultType": "vector",
166+
"result": [
167+
{
168+
"metric": {},
169+
"value": [
170+
1629244800,
171+
"1.0048849323728253"
172+
]
173+
}
174+
]
175+
}
176+
},
177+
"http://ubuntu:9090/api/v1/query?query=histogram_quantile(0.05, sum(rate(attestation_gossip_slot_start_delay_time_bucket[19d])) by (le)) &time=1629244800": {
178+
"status": "success",
179+
"data": {
180+
"resultType": "vector",
181+
"result": [
182+
{
183+
"metric": {},
184+
"value": [
185+
1629244800,
186+
"0.7255775376558251"
187+
]
188+
}
189+
]
190+
}
191+
}
192+
}
193+
}

0 commit comments

Comments
 (0)